XmlSchemaCollection.ValidationEventHandler Event

Sets an event handler for receiving information about the XDR and XML schema validation errors.

Remarks
These events occur when the schemas are added to the collection. If an event handler is not provided, an XmlSchemaException is thrown on any validation errors where the Severity is XmlSeverityType.Error
. To specify an event handler, define a callback function and add it to the ValidationEventHandler
.
Important
The XmlSchemaCollection class is obsolete in .NET Framework version 2.0 and has been replaced by the XmlSchemaSet class.
